    Description

    Timberland is a German family game about woodland management in the old days.
    Play is card driven according to the four seasons; fruit falls from the trees in the Autumn; in Winter, wild boar eat the fruit and run through the woods depositing seeds as they go; in the Spring and Summer the seeds grow into trees; and thereafter the trees are cut down by the axe-wielding woodcutter. Players select cards and maneuver the boar and the woodcutter in order to get the largest stand of contiguous trees.

    Ages 8 and up.
